Australian-based Meisner Management Agency is reporting that one of their clients, Isabel Lucas, has been attached to appear in Transformers 2 as “Alice”. Ms. Lucas (IMDB profile) is a relative newcomer to the international audience, but is most well known to Australians for her role in the TV Series Home and Away.
